Picture Business is proud to announce the release of a new premium docuseries that its served as Executive Producer on, titled Access All Areas: Erebus Motorsport. The show follows the 2 year journey of Australian Supercars team, Erebus Motorsport, as they deal with the challenges of continuing to race during a worldwide pandemic, sponsors, team changes, lockdowns, race stoppages and more. The show premiered on Fox Sports Australia on March 2nd 2022 and will be available on Fox Sports Australia, KayoSports.com.au and 7Network, with more broadcasters and international availability coming soon. The trailer for our long awaited film, Without Ward, starring Michael Gladis, James Duvall, Alexis Dizena and Martin Landau has debuted on ComingSoon.Net check it out here: Without Ward Trailer Debut - ComingSoon.Net  Without Ward is written and directed by Cory Cataldo. The film is produced by Mike Klassen, Mitch Rosin, Sean Roldan, Cory Cataldo, Michael Gladis, Laura Holloway, Lisa Gallant, and Jay Raftery. Executive producers include Larry & David Frascella, Anthony Salamon, Cassian Yee, and Sean Roldan. The movie is produced by Picture Business and distributed by Buffalo 8.

Pciture Business International has added Katch Media’s CEO, Andrew Tight - a former animation producer at Lionsgate, to its advisory board. Andrew has taken his expertise in art and film to soaring heights producing twelve movies with Lionsgate Entertainment and launching three successful franchises with them. He is currently the Co-Founder and CEO of Katch Entertainment. Katch is an entertainment data company providing entertainment industry executives the data-driven insights they need to make actionable decisions to increase profitability and better target audiences. Utilizing the entertainment Genome, created by Dr Nolan Gasser, Katch can build messaging and marketing campaigns informed by audinece taste and values with insights for audience segments and fully integrated targeting and ad buying.

PBI Animation has signed on european directing superstar, Salvador Simo, to direct its newest animated feature, Fernando Flamenco. Salvador is a film director and scriptwriter. He started studying Animation at the American Animation Institute of Los Angeles in 1991 while also working at the Bill Melendez Prod Studio on a special Charlie Brown feature. When he returned to Europe he worked in the field of traditional animation for several companies, including Disney in Paris, where he lived for two years. Subsequently, he returned to Barcelona where he continued working for Disney and set up a studio that worked exclusively for that same company (Disney), during three years, while studying Film Directing at the CECC, and making a couple of shortfilms in animation, one of them in the Animation Workshop in Denmark where he worked as teacher for a year and a half. Thereafter, Salvador moved to London to work in MPC’s department of pre-visualisation & layout, in projects like Narnia, Prince Caspian, The Werewolf, Prince of Persia, and the James Bond movie Skyfall, where his knowledge on cinematography & animation opened many doors for him. In 2008 he began directing a cg animation series in Asia, eventually shooting over 500 minutes of film. Then, in 2014, MPC again offered him a job. This time as head of film sequences in the animation feature movie The Jungle Book, produced by Disney, as well as in Pirates of the Caribbean: Dead Men Tell no Tales. In 2016 he moved back to Spain to direct the Buñuel feature film project: Buñuel in the Labyrinth of the Turtles which premiered in October 2018 at the Animation Film Festival of Los Angeles, where he was awarded the Jury Prize. Buñuel in the Labyrinth of the Turtles was also awarded in 2019 in the European Academy Film Awards for the Best European Animated Feature Film, and in the 34th Goya Awards for Best Animated Film where he was nominated into the category of Best New Director, and Awarded the Medal of CEC, Film Writers Medal, for the Best New Director, first time awarded an animated film. In 2019 was the first time an animated film is on the shortlist, 3 candidates, to represent Spain in the Academy Oscar Awards in the category of International Film, sharing nomination with Pedro Almodóvar and Alejandro Amenábar. In 2019 Salvador was awarded with the Cartoon Tribute to the Best European Director on 2019. In 2020 is awarded with the Platino Award from the Iberoamerican Cinema to the Best Animated Feature. Picture Business has formed a Distribution Mnetorship Program. The program offers independent producers a chance to leverage PBI’s relationships and knowledge and get some much valued assistance in securing distribution for their film. Producers needs an outlet for their content and the one thing they don’t really teach you in film school is how to get that crucial distribution deal… The new program will allow independant producers to work with PBI as their Executive Producers in securing a distribution deal through PBI’s reputation and relationships. PBI will acquire information, research and identify platforms and windows, provide guidance, navigate and provide support and provide performance reports, while acting as the outward facing production company of record. Using their vast network PBI will be able to get deals across the globe, on multiple streaming platforms, VOD, AVOD and SVOD platforms as well as in more traditional methods, like direct to consumer sales.
